Coding Isn’t Just About Writing Code
Here’s the biggest misconception most parents carry into their first search for coding classes for kids: they imagine something complicated, screen-heavy, or too advanced for their child’s age.
Early coding education isn’t about mastering syntax. It’s about teaching children to think logically – to break a problem into steps, find a pattern, and try again when something doesn’t work. These are the same habits that make someone a great scientist, entrepreneur, designer, or doctor.

When kids learn coding early, they stop being passive consumers of technology and start becoming active creators. That’s a powerful identity shift – and it happens faster than most parents expect.

Why Experiential Learning Makes All the Difference
Think about how children actually learn best. It’s rarely from watching a video or listening to an explanation. It’s from doing – building something, making a mistake, figuring out why, and trying again.
